Description

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ory ('Path Traversal') (CWE-22) in the Kibana Fleet feature can lead to the unauthorized deletion of resources via Path Traversal (CAPEC-126). A low-privileged user could cause a subsequent action taken by a higher-privileged user in the Fleet administration interface to act on an unintended target, resulting in the deletion of resources including accounts with elevated privileges.

CWE ID Description
CWE-22 The product uses external input to construct a pathname that is intended to identify a file or directory that is located underneath a restricted parent directory, but the product does not properly neutralize special elements within the pathname that can cause the pathname to resolve to a location that is outside of the restricted directory.

Executive Summary

CVE-2026-78591 is a Path Traversal vulnerability in Kibana's Fleet feature. It allows a low-privileged user to manipulate file paths in the Fleet administration interface, causing higher-privileged users to unintentionally delete resources, including accounts with elevated privileges.

Detection Guidance

To detect this vulnerability, check if your Kibana instance is running a vulnerable version (8.19.16 or earlier in 8.x, 9.3.5 or earlier in 9.x, or 9.4.0 to 9.4.2). Verify if Fleet is enabled and if multiple users with differing privilege levels have access to Fleet configuration.

Impact Analysis

This vulnerability could lead to unauthorized deletion of critical resources such as user accounts, data, or configurations. Attackers with low privileges might trick administrators into performing harmful actions, potentially disrupting operations or compromising system integrity.

Mitigation Strategies

Immediately upgrade Kibana to a patched version: 8.19.17, 9.3.6, or 9.4.3. If upgrading is not possible, disable the Fleet feature as a temporary measure. Ensure only trusted users have access to Fleet configuration.
